Visual imagery scanning in young adults with intellectual disability

Summary
Intellectual disability did not impair mental imagery scanning abilities in young adults. Despite slower overall scan times, their scanning rate matched that of college students, suggesting intact imagery capacities.

Background:
- Intellectual disability (ID) can impact cognitive functions, including spatial processing and mental imagery.
- Understanding the specific cognitive profiles of individuals with ID is crucial for targeted interventions.
Purpose of the Study:
- To investigate spatial imagery and scanning abilities in young adults with intellectual disability compared to college students.
- To determine if individuals with ID exhibit deficits in mental image inspection.
Main Methods:
- Participants learned landmark locations on a map.
- A scanning task was performed under perception (visible landmarks) and imagery (invisible landmarks) conditions.
- Scan times and rates were measured for both groups and conditions.
Main Results:
- The rate of scanning over distance was similar for perception and imagery conditions across both groups.
- Overall scan times were slower in the imagery condition for all participants.
- Participants with intellectual disability required more trials to learn locations and had slower overall scan times, but their scanning rate was comparable.
Conclusions:
- Individuals with intellectual disability show no significant deficit in mental image inspection.
- The findings suggest that persons with intellectual disability may possess relatively good imagery capacities.
- Cognitive strategies for spatial tasks may differ, but fundamental imagery abilities appear preserved.
